Decentramento di Astar con Light Client
Non sono sicuro che tu abbia sentito, ma Astar è il primo parachain su Polkadot a supportare Light Client tramite Polkadot{JS}. Anche se questo è vero, la prima squadra a farlo su Kusama è stata quella dei nostri amici di Invarch e del GM parachain. Sono pionieri nello spazio e sono grato per il lavoro di Gabe !
Perché è un grosso problema?
È enorme per il decentramento dell'infrastruttura di back-end su cui si basa oggi il front-end.
Come disse Elon Musk: ''La parte migliore non è la parte. Il miglior processo è nessun processo. Non pesa niente. Non costa nulla.'' Anche se non ci interessa il peso del servizio RPC, se non c'è allora non può rompersi! Quindi un singolo punto di errore in meno è una grande vittoria per la resilienza della rete Astar.
Se il servizio RPC non costa nulla, né gli utenti né gli sviluppatori devono sopportare l'onere di pagare per l'infrastruttura RPC. Sebbene continueremo sicuramente a supportare gli RPC come un modo efficace per consentire agli utenti di accedere alla rete, supportare i client leggeri significa che i costi per questo servizio saranno inferiori ei progetti possono reindirizzare tali fondi ad altri sviluppi. Ancora più importante, gli sviluppatori non dovranno pagare per i servizi per costruire e ridimensionare le loro dApp . Posso dire uno scenario win-win-win?
Dove viene utilizzato?
Il sito Web Polkadot {JS} è un ottimo punto di partenza e dimostra le possibilità e i limiti dei client leggeri così come esistono in questo momento.
Lo stiamo implementando anche nel portale Astar dApps, ancora una volta come vetrina per ispirare i team a fare lo stesso con i loro progetti.
La documentazione su come farlo sarà disponibile in modo che gli sviluppatori possano utilizzare facilmente i client leggeri per i loro progetti mentre utilizzano la rete Astar; il semplice fatto di questo decentralizza ulteriormente la nostra blockchain.
Cos'è un servizio RPC?
I nodi RPC sono il punto di ingresso di tutte le connessioni dall'esterno della blockchain. Sono utilizzati per pubblicare transazioni e interrogare i dati della catena da utenti e dApp. È un livello di traduzione da un protocollo all'altro. Questo è lo status quo, come stanno le cose adesso.
È la parte più centralizzata di un ecosistema blockchain perché solo pochi endpoint servono tutte le richieste al di fuori della blockchain. Richiedere ricompense per lo staking, votare on-chain o fare offerte per il tuo NFT preferito, tutto passa attraverso un servizio centralizzato affidabile.
Un altro motivo per cui potresti non volere RPC è innanzitutto non fare del male (dal giuramento di Ippocrate) . Mentre una cosa è che un endpoint può rompersi, un'altra è che può essere compromesso (dirottamento DNS), utilizzato in modo dannoso (attacchi di overflow del buffer) o esistere come un raccoglitore di metadati apparentemente innocuo (problemi con la raccolta di indirizzi IP, chiunque?) . Questi sono i potenziali rischi per l'utente che vogliamo affrontare.
“ I client leggeri, al fine di evitare efficacemente i server RPC, un punto di strozzatura molto ovvio per qualsiasi rete apparentemente decentralizzata, dovranno essere innovati. Dovranno essere creati e dovranno essere resi estremamente performanti per garantire che l'esperienza dell'utente nelle applicazioni decentralizzate sia praticabile ", Gavin Wood.
E questo mi porta alla necessità di ridurre la nostra dipendenza dal servizio RPC. Proprio come i nostri antenati cypherpunk hanno visto la necessità di creare criptovalute per disintermediare banche e denaro fiat, vediamo la necessità di creare un'opzione per consentire agli utenti di staccarsi dall'affidarsi interamente a nodi centralizzati .
Disintermediare significa rimuovere gli intermediari, o in questo caso il middleware. Ciò ci avvicinerà di un passo al sogno del pieno decentramento, dell'utilità inarrestabile e della libertà di essere sovrani dei nostri dati, della nostra identità e della nostra valuta per le generazioni a venire.
Come usarlo?
- Installa Substrate Connect Extension (Questo andrà via più tardi...)
- Vai su polkadot.js.org/apps e scegli Astar da Polkadot, light client .
- Hai già finito. Usa come al solito e nota l'angolo in alto a destra smoldot-light-wasm per essere cool e verifica.
A proposito di Astar
Astar Network : il futuro degli smart contract per multichain.
Astar Network supporta la creazione di dApp con contratti intelligenti EVM e WASM e offre agli sviluppatori una vera interoperabilità, con cross-consensus messaging (XCM). L'esclusivo modello Build2Earn di Astar consente agli sviluppatori di essere pagati attraverso un meccanismo di picchettamento delle dApp per il codice che scrivono e le dApp che creano.
Il vibrante ecosistema di Astar è diventato il principale Parachain di Polkadot a livello globale, supportato da tutti i principali scambi e VC di livello 1. Astar offre agli sviluppatori la flessibilità di tutti gli strumenti Ethereum e WASM per iniziare a costruire le loro dApp. Per accelerare la crescita su Polkadot e Kusama Networks, Astar SpaceLabs offre un hub di incubazione per le migliori dApp TVL.
Sito web | Cinguettio | Discordia | Telegramma | Git Hub | Reddit

![Che cos'è un elenco collegato, comunque? [Parte 1]](https://post.nghiatu.com/assets/images/m/max/724/1*Xokk6XOjWyIGCBujkJsCzQ.jpeg)



































